Unable to provide utility due to server permission issues, content and features are currently inaccessible.
Unfortunately, the website "http://www.similarweb.com/" is inaccessible due to a server permission issue. As a result, users are unable to access any content or features on the site. The server returns a "Reference #18.ca82617.1691779571.3d12e16a" error message when attempting to access the site. This error message suggests that the server has restricted access or denied permission to the user. Consequently, it is not possible to provide a comprehensive summary of the website's utility as it cannot be accessed at this time.